A complaint has been registered against Delhi Chief Minister and Aam Aadmi Party leader Atishi for allegedly using a government vehicle for election-related activities on January 8, violating the Model Code of Conduct. Meta is set to receive a summons from the Parliamentary Standing Committee on Communication and Information Technology after Chairman Nishikant Dubey accused Mark Zuckerberg of spreading misinformation regarding the 2024 Indian general election. Launching a scathing attack on Prime Minister Narendra Modi for not visiting violence-hit Manipur, the Congress on Tuesday said that he has found time, inclination and energy to go all over the world but has not seen it necessary to reach out to the distressed people in the northeastern state.

India summoned Bangladesh's acting High Commissioner, Nural Islam, on Monday to address concerns over the stalled border fencing project, urging Dhaka to implement previous agreements aimed at preventing illegal activities along the border. Bengaluru-based startup Pixxel announced the launch of three of the world's highest-resolution commercial hyperspectral satellites from the Vandenberg Space Force Base in California on Wednesday. A Republican lawmaker has asked the US Department of Justice to preserve all records in connection with the "selective prosecution" of billionaire industrialist Gautam Adani and his group of companies by the Biden administration. The demand comes less than a week before the Donald Trump administration takes office.

The Union Home Ministry has granted sanction to the Enforcement Directorate to prosecute former Delhi chief minister and AAP national convenor Arvind Kejriwal in the excise policy linked money laundering case, officials said. President of Singapore Tharman Shanmugaratnam arrived here on Tuesday night on a five-day visit that aims to further boost bilateral ties in a range of areas. External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ar on Tuesday called on Spanish President Pedro Sanchez and reiterated the "long-standing" India-Spain partnership, updating him on the progress in bilateral cooperation.
